This is a contract position open exclusively to candidates who are located in and legally authorized to provide services in Canada. Applications from candidates located outside of Canada will not be considered.

About Our Company

Kanopi Studios is a Design, Development & Support Agency with a fully distributed team of experts in Drupal & WordPress.

Our clients are mission-driven - and so are we. We design, build, and support websites that help their missions thrive.

We believe the people behind the work matter just as much as the work itself. That’s why we’re deeply committed to supporting our team’s growth, well-being, and success. When our people thrive, our clients do too - and together, we build a web that works better for everyone.

As Kanopi continues to grow, we're looking to engage a Contract Senior UX/UI Designer (Website Strategy & Design) on a contract basis.

About The Job

At Kanopi, we design, build, and support websites for clients who are doing meaningful work. We’re looking for a Contract Senior UX/UI Designer (Website Strategy & Design) who can help clients make sense of complex website challenges and turn that clarity into thoughtful, accessible, and effective digital experiences.

This is a hands-on role. You’ll lead and support discovery, shape UX and content strategy, create information architecture, wireframes, prototypes, and polished visual designs, then present your work clearly to clients and internal teams. You’ll be comfortable explaining the thinking behind your recommendations and empowering clients to make confident decisions.

Your engagement will also have you serve as a creative voice in our sales process and marketing process. That means joining conversations with prospective clients, contributing to proposals and project approaches, and showing how strategy-led design can create better outcomes for our prospective clients. You’ll help share Kanopi’s point of view through marketing and thought leadership, including webinars, blog posts, case studies, and other informational content.

We’re looking for someone who can think strategically, design with care, communicate clearly, and help make the web work better for everyone. This is a fully remote position, and the engagement is managed by the Director of Strategy and Creative.

You can expect to contribute in the following areas:

    • Lead Project Discovery
      • Conduct interest-holder interviews
      • Translate research and client input into actionable design direction
      • Assess qualitative and quantitative datasets and formulate meaningful recommendations that balance user and business goals.
      • Conduct UX, content and design audits and articulate your findings to internal and client teams.
      • Conduct and synthesize actionable insights from user research and testing
    • Develop Information architecture and content strategy:
      • Synthesize information architecture, navigation and sitemap strategy
      • Conduct content audits and gap analysis
      • Develop tone, voice and taxonomies to guide content creation
      • Ability to understand and articulate how content strategy shapes design
    • Produce visual design and strategy artifacts including, but not limited to:
      • Wireframes
      • Page templates
      • Interactive prototypes
      • Full-fidelity visual comps
      • UI component libraries and static or interactive responsive design systems
    • Sales and Marketing
      • Act as a senior creative voice in sales conversations
      • Help uncover client goals, risks, constraints, and opportunities during pre-sales discovery
      • Contribute design and strategy perspective to proposals, estimates, scopes, and project approaches
      • Contribute to Kanopi thought leadership through webinars, blog posts, case studies, conference ideas, or educational content

About the Compensation and Work Requirements

This is an independent contractor engagement. Work is project-based, hours will vary, and no minimum hours are guaranteed. Contractors invoice at their contracted hourly rate. The expected hourly rate range for this role is $50 - $70 CAD, depending on experience and skills. Please note the top of this range is firm and non-negotiable.

This is a 100% remote role. Applicants must be legally authorized to work in Canada, reside in British Columbia, Alberta, Yukon, or the Northwest Territories, and be available for regular collaboration during Pacific Time business hours. We are not able to provide visa sponsorship for this position.

Applications will be accepted on an ongoing basis until the position is filled.

Now, let’s talk about you!



Requirements

What you’ll bring:

  • Senior-level, hands-on UX/UI design experience for complex, content-rich websites, with a strong portfolio that shows your process from discovery and strategy through high-fidelity visual design
  • Strong visual design craft, including layout, typography, hierarchy, brand application, responsive design, and accessible UI patterns
  • Advanced Figma skills, including prototyping, design systems, component workflows, and client-ready presentation files
  • Advanced knowledge of UX strategy, content strategy, information architecture, and content experience principles
  • Demonstrated experience in a creative agency environment
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to adapt your message for designers, developers, and clients, making complex ideas clear, useful, and actionable for each audience
  • A collaborative approach to untangling complex creative and strategic challenges, with a focus on practical, thoughtful solutions

Nice to have:

  • Coding experience
  • Working knowledge of WordPress and/or Drupal
  • Experience working in the higher-education, mission-driven or healthcare sectors

How we use AI in our hiring process.

In the interest of fostering a fair and unbiased recruitment process, we use artificial intelligence (AI) technology to assist in reviewing job applications. Specifically, AI tools may be used to anonymize applications to mitigate potential bias and to assist in the initial assessment of qualifications against the criteria listed in this posting.

AI is never the sole basis for a decision. All selection decisions are made with human review and oversight, and no applicant is rejected solely by an automated tool. We regularly review our processes and the tools we use to monitor for accuracy and potential bias, and to ensure alignment with the fair treatment of applicants and with applicable federal, provincial, and territorial law.

If you would like more information about how AI is used in our process, wish to request an accommodation, or prefer that your application be reviewed without the use of automated tools, please contact us at hr@kanopi.com, and we will work with you.
